
Date: Wednesday, Feb. 25, 2009
Time: 6-8pm
Place: Church
Bring: a dish to share, which has been made using at least 1 ingredient from your food storage.
Copies of Recipes: We’d love to make copies of your recipe so everyone can take one as they taste it. Email them to us or hand it to Clark or Linda and we’ll have the recipes ready for you.
Different Stations with Different Information:
Plan it Station: Get a “customized” 52 Week Food Storage Purchasing Plan (Download Excel Spreadsheet set .25 margins on all sides for printing or new PDF) with a Starter Menu (Download PDF Flyer) which uses the ingredients from your 52 week plan.
Buy It Station: Get inside info on how to save money using coupons, see example shopping trips and total savings, and know the top websites to go to in order to print lists, coupons and compare prices. Also sign-up to purchase dry beans in Bulk for only $0.50 /lb. (Download PDF Buy It Flyer)
Make It Stations: See different Wheat Grinders, know the Alternate Methods of Cooking without Electricity (Download PDF Flyer), Learn the Dutch Oven Cooking Temperatures (Download PDF Flyer), Learn How to make a Box Oven (Download PDF Flyer) and Learn How to Dehydrate Fruit.
Eat It Stations: Wheat Blender Pancakes Demo & Tasting and sample dishes which have been made using at least 1 ingredient from food storage and take a copy of the recipe if you like what you taste.
